SB 10.37.25

Devanāgarī

भगवानपि गोविन्दो हत्वा केशिनमाहवे । पशूनपालयत् पालै: प्रीतैर्व्रजसुखावह: ॥ २५ ॥

Text

bhagavān api govindo hatvā keśinam āhave paśūn apālayat pālaiḥ prītair vraja-sukhāvahaḥ

Synonyms

bhagavān—the Supreme Lord;api—and;govindaḥ—Govinda;hatvā—having killed;keśinam—the demon Keśī;āhave—in battle;paśūn—the animals;apālayat—He tended;pālaiḥ—together with the cowherd boys;prītaiḥ—who were pleased;vraja—to the inhabitants of Vṛndāvana;sukha—happiness;āvahaḥ—bringing.

Translation

After killing the demon Keśī in battle, the Supreme Personality of Godhead continued to tend the cows and other animals in the company of His joyful cowherd boyfriends. Thus He brought happiness to all the residents of Vṛndāvana.
